CHICAGO (May 14, 2018) – Loyola University Chicago junior pitcher
Kiley Jones (Valparaiso, Ind./Portage) was one of 13 individuals named to the Missouri Valley Conference Softball Scholar-Athlete First Team it was announced today. The righthander was one of three Ramblers to earn MVC Scholar-Athlete distinction, with
Shannon McGee (Chardon, Ohio/Berkshire) and
Brooke Wilson (Orland Park, Ill./Marist) collecting honorable mention accolades.
Jones, who carries a 3.49 grade-point average as a social work major, had another impressive season in 2018, posting a 17-12 record with a 1.86 earned-run average and 107 strikeouts in 188.0 innings of work. The Second Team All-MVC selection completed 24 of her 30 starts this season, blanking the opposition on seven occasions. Since the start of the 2017 campaign she has been the winning pitcher in 36 of Loyola's 50 victories.
Earning MVC Scholar-Athlete Team Honorable Mention status for the first time in their careers were McGee and Wilson. A sophomore outfielder and business major, McGee, who last week was named First Team All-MVC, batted .377 (60-for-159) with 10 doubles, four triples, two home runs and 21 RBI this season. Wilson, a junior outfielder, had her best offensive season as a Rambler, hitting .268 (40-for-149) with five doubles, three triples, a home run and a career-best 19 RBI. The psychology major was named Google Cloud Academic All-District V last week.
In order to be eligible for MVC Scholar-Athlete Team honors, student-athletes must have a cumulative grade-point average of 3.20 or higher, be at least a sophomore in athletic and academic standing, and meet certain playing requirements.
